I remember reading a few years ago an article reproduced in a local paper, about the mill girls' day out. Apparently, they took the trains from up the Stroud valleys to Sharpness, where they boarded - I assume - the Waverley. At high water, they steamed to Ilfracombe. I day spent on the beach & in the pubs, they took the next flood back to Sharpness, trains & home. A mammoth undertaking, even by today's standard!
